Youth Empowerment & Goal Achievement
Our research in this sector focuses on identifying the barriers that prevent young people from reaching their full potential. We analyze educational gaps, psychosocial needs, and the impact of mentorship on long-term success.
Investigating the effectiveness of pro bono work placements and apprenticeship models in building professional competence.
Evaluating the role of competitive learning, such as our quiz initiatives, in fostering civic pride and leadership values.
Researching economic stabilizers that allow youth to thrive in their home communities, reducing the risks associated with irregular migration.

- Health Improvement: Women, Infants, & Children (WIC)
Health is the foundation of every thriving society. IPID’s health research focuses on the most vulnerable demographics to ensure a healthier tomorrow.
Maternal Health Outcomes: Identifying ways to improve prenatal and postnatal care through community-based health education and resource allocation.
Pediatric Nutrition & Growth: Researching the impact of nutritional interventions during the first 1,000 days of life to combat infant mortality and promote healthy development.
Systemic Healthcare Access: Investigating the logistical and financial barriers to healthcare for women and children, and developing collaborative partnership models to close these gaps.
